Celebrate love in soft, romantic colour with PINK POP, a luxury boxed flower arrangement from Flowers Soho. Tender pink and white shades of roses and carnations are artfully combined with orange and yellow roses and lush greenery to create a bouquet that truly touches the heart. Perfect for anniversaries, birthdays, proposals or just because, this pink flower box adds an elegant pop of colour to any room.

Handcrafted in Soho by our expert florists, each arrangement is presented in a premium hat box for maximum impact the moment it's delivered. We guarantee 5 days of freshness and deliver the roses in bud so you can enjoy watching them bloom. Guard petals are left on during transit to protect the inner petals and can be gently removed on arrival for a flawless finish.
